ARC Review - Fall of the Horizon by Jessica J. Ayala

 Thank you so much Jessica J. Ayala for sending me this ARC!

Title: Fall of the Horizon
Author: Jessica J. Ayala
Genre: Fantasy Romance
Series: Dusk and Dawn (book #1)
Pages: 578

Synopsis:

The War of the Skies is over, the gods are gone, and the new world has begun . . .

Zara Santos is the adopted daughter of the Ikarrian king and mercenary of her kingdom’s guild, though throughout the Continent of Ribera she is known as the Rogue—the High King’s personal assassin. Every hunting season she kills in the hope to one day be free of her shackles. When Zara receives a unique assignment to hunt down the mysterious leader of the shadow markets, she will do whatever it takes to gain her freedom. 

The war has left Ronan Menodora a shadow of the male he once was. The archangel grapples with the underworld to provide for those he cares about as retribution for the failures of his past. When various cities are destroyed, their citizens disappearing, he makes a dreadful discovery that threatens the survival of his business and seeks the help of the infamous mercenary. 

As the unlikely pair delve deeper into the strange happenings of the Continent, along with the help of their close allies, rumors rise of the return of the Three Sun Gods—the main Primordials believed to be long lost to the mortal world—and the mystery behind the missing people may pose a greater threat than anticipated.


Review & thoughts:


Fall of the Horizon is the first book in a Fantasy Romance series with angels, fae, vampires, gods, morally grey characters and slow burn romance that I really enjoyed!


After the fall of her kingdom, Zara is forced to become a mercenary and take part in a hunt organized by the High King every year. When this year’s hunt takes her and her guild deep into the criminal parts of the city and Zara is tasked with killing their leader, the last thing she expects is for the handsome archangel who appears in the most unexpected moments to be her target. But when rumors start spreading about mysterious and powerful beings seen near the city and more people show up dead, Zara and Ronan need to work together even if it puts their lives and everyone they care about in danger. 


This book starts slow, but once we get introduced to all the characters and get to know the basics of the world building, it quickly picks up and I couldn’t put it down. The world the author created is really complex and fascinating, I loved discovering all of it with the main characters and hope we will get to see even more in the next book. I loved our main characters, Zara and Ronan. They are both really strong, morally grey, have tragic pasts and I loved how they went from enemies to reluctant allies to friends to lovers and began to heal together, they had a really slow burn romance, but I loved all their scenes together, how they began to be vulnerable with each other and all the tension, it was so satisfying when they finally gave in and decided to just be together. We also got to see the POVs of Daria, Zara’s adopted sister and Ares, a vampire general and her bodyguard and I liked reading about their story and their romance, they were polar opposites but perfect for each other and I can’t wait to see both couples again. There were also so many amazing side characters and I loved the found family trope, it was so well written here and I already miss Axar, Hakim, Eshe and Idris. While I mentioned this book starts a bit slow, the plot was medium paced and there were many plot twists, secrets and betrayals that made the book impossible to put down. 


Fall of the Horizon is a really great fantasy romance book with interesting world building and plot, amazing characters and slow burn romance that I definitely recommend and already can’t wait for book 2!
